art & utility

Currently I am organizing an exhibition at the West Wales Schools of The Arts @ colegsirgar tilted Art & Utility. The aim of the exhibition is to bring together visual artists and potters in a mixed show of ceramic plates. Many of the artists and ceramicists have a national or International exhibiting profile I have also included recent graduates from New Designers 2009 and students from the college. The show runs from 4th Nov – Dec 4th. The exhibition for me marks the start of a personal aim to make utilitarian work.

fill me up

A pencil drawing on board exploring the relationship between vessels and the body. This  drawing was exhibited in Spain - Figueres, as part of the Transitar a group show with Lluis Penaranda and Juliette Murphy two Catalan artists.

‘Ymrwymiad’


Exhibited at 2009 National Eisteddfod

‘Ymrwymiad’ – is a sculptural vessel that brings together a ceramic cast of a human leg bone,model trees and comfrey seeds. The seeds are contained within the cavity of the
bone creating a storage devise and cultural signifier. The meaning of this
sculptural vessel is intentionally open ended for viewer. My motivation as an
artist & designer is to evoke connection and commitment that exist between
the body and the land. For many of us today the links between the land are
remote and increasingly virtual. For me I see a direct link between the body
and the land, in the case of ‘Ymrwymiad’ specifically connections to Llandudoch
and St.Dogmael.
